Output f921ee26597f134f7f57c063077f76266b94dea0bb7ea6632d88e6ebc6dbdae4:0

value
21351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17a31589a370cd20ce7589cdcbf0b26001fac7e6 OP_EQUAL
address
33qzqEsUAQgNMRFZSuYQy8ZSb4mp8oZq6h
transaction
f921ee26597f134f7f57c063077f76266b94dea0bb7ea6632d88e6ebc6dbdae4
confirmations
242673
spent
true